Best anti-corrosion brake rotors?
Anyone not watching MonsterGarage?
I did a search, and you can get zinc, cadmium, and nickle plated rear brake rotors. Anyone in a cold, snowy, salt encrusted area can say any of these stay rust free better than the others?
I might replace my rear rotors right now, don't want to spend alot, but hate rusty looking brakes.
Anyone know if the $20 at Autozone are coated and provide any rust prevention?
Thanks.

What happens is the coating wears right off where the pads rub, but the rest of it stays looking OK[the 'swept' surface will still rust in time /lack of use]
My powerslots were cad plated..
I doubt very much if the regular [cheap ones] are plated..

Mine have been zinc plated.
Mtrhds is right. Basically where the brake pads ride, it wears off the plating. Anywhere else the plating holds up. Even against the environment. I've had mine on for 2 years and they still look good. And that's throughout the winters with salty roads.
